IT개발/Linux & Unix2009. 6. 29. 14:00
crontab 명령

시스템의 주기적인 작업을 하기 위해서 등록하는 명령어

형식
분(minute)    시(hour)    day(일)    month(월)    weekday(요일)    명령어(command)

분(minute)   : 0-59
시(hour)      : 0-23
day(일)       : 1-31
month(월)    : 1-12
weekday(요일) : 0-6

사용예1> 매일 0시0분에 vmProc.sh 를 실행시킨다.
0 0 * * * /home/voip/log/vmProc.sh

사용예2> 매일 0시5분에 해당 명령어를 실행시킨다.  
5 0 * * * /home/logs/find /home/logs/  -type f -maxdepth 1 -mtime +30 -exec mv {} /home/logs/backup \;
<TIP> 시간에 대한 형식을 하나씩 적지 않고 수식을 작성하는것이 가능하다.
 */2 * * * * 실행명령어  <==  0,2,4,6,8,...,58  * * * * (2분 간격으로 수행)
Posted by 시티락